Hot on the heels of Han Yue’s stunning tightest car parallel parking record earlier this month comes another spectacular motoring stunt to make the history books.

In the video below, a semi-truck flies through the air over an F1 racing car, landing safely to set a new Guinness World Records title for the longest ramp jump by a truck and trailer after achieving a distance of 83 feet, 7 inches.

Organised by cloud computing firm EMC who are technology partners for Lotus F1 team, the stunt took place earlier this month to promote their "redefining motorsports" campaign.

Behind the wheel of the semi-truck was Mike Ryan, an experienced HGV stunt rider, while the F1 Racer was bravely piloted by Martin Ivanov.

Somewhat unsurprisingly, both men have worked as stunt drivers in not only the Fast and the Furious series, but also the James Bond and Bourne films.
